Poker Acronyms

Confused by what another poker players has said? You may have just run into one of the many poker acronyms that are commonly used in online poker games.

Browse the following list for definitions of the most popular online poker acronyms.

AF - Aggression Factor
B&M - Brick and Mortar
BB - Big Blind
BB/100 - Big Blinds per 100 hands
BR - Bank Roll
CO - Cut-Off Position, last seat before the button
CR - Check Raise
EP - Early Position
EV - Expected Value, (written as EV, EV+ or EV-)
GB - Good Bet
GG - Good Game
GL - Good Luck
HH - Hand History
HU - Heads Up
ITM - In The Money
LAG - Loose AGgressive
LHE - Limit Texas Holdem
LOL - Laughing Out Loud
LP - Late Position
MHIG - My Hand Is Good
MHING - My Hand Is Not Good
MP - Middle Position
MTT - Multi-Table Tournament
NH - Nice Hand
NLHE - No-Limit Texas Holdem
OOP Out Of Position
OESD - Open-Ended Straight Draw
OESFD - Open-Ended Straight Flush Draw
OTB - On The Button
PF - Pre-Flop
PFR - Pre-Flop Raise
PLO - Pot-Limit Omaha
PP - Pocket Pair
ROI - Return On Investment
SB - Small Blind
SD - Showdown
SNG - Sit And Go tournament
STT - Single Table Tournament
TAG - Tight AGgressive
TPBK - Top Pair Bad Kicker
TPGK - Top Pair Good Kicker
TPLK - Top Pair Low Kicker
TPTK - Top Pair Top Kicker
TPWK - Top Pair Weak Kicker
TY - Thank You
UTG - Under The Gun, the first seat after the big blind position
VNH - Very Nice Hand
WPT - World Poker Tour
WSOP - World Series Of Poker
WR - Win Rate
